Output 11a6fae040b58ffd29d28efb8265296e52eb241eae5e9ca59cdccf6441647bb6:0

value
23959060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15fef8562cb1dc319bf4d57f1bea3674f47e1deb OP_EQUALVERIFY OP_CHECKSIG
address
131JdfEJFyfA3CEG116tpkfkJzyq7Wkk4j
transaction
11a6fae040b58ffd29d28efb8265296e52eb241eae5e9ca59cdccf6441647bb6
spent
true